This wonderful coffee originates from Eastern Uganda, near Mt. Elgon.
The Coffee Gardens, a long-standing partner of Falcon Coffees.
The Coffee Gardens was established in 2017 with the goal of producing specialty coffee in an ethical way, offering a transparent and direct link between coffee farmers and coffee consumers. At the heart of their business model is the concept of the triple-bottom-line, where economic, social, and environmental goals are equally valued and prioritised. A healthy environment and motivated producers are crucial to producing and maintaining quality in coffee. Conversely, environmental degradation and farmer vulnerability are a threat to our future.
This lot is a Drugar (DRied UGandan Arabica). It’s a common natural process found in Uganda – typically in the Rwenzori region out West. This process is characterised by cherries sun-dried whole, often smallholder-produced on patios, tarps or on the ground and then transported to processing centres where they’re all mixed together. THis is a bit of a contract to the traditional naturals in which cherry is collected and processed altogether, yielding greater standardisation, higher quality and consistency. That said, Drugars are now really good and they carry a unique fruit-driven weightier profile that have made them popular blend components. This is an exceptional example.
It is delicious as a cold brew and we recommend as a filter coffee - v60, aeropress. It is good as an espresso based coffee but may take a little adjusting - we have found it needs to be go more fine than other coffee’s in order to get a great extraction, and a bigger dose. For example, we have done 21g, slightly finer setting, to get 36g over 32 seconds.
Cold brew willneed to the opposite end of the scale in grind. A very coarse setting to slowly extract overnight and it is worth the wait!
